Ticket: HOOK-887 — Webhook delivery key expired

The Fernwick dispatcher's internal key for the webhook-delivery service expired overnight, so all outbound deliveries are failing and entering the retry queue. Note the retry semantics: exponential backoff capped at six attempts, after which events land in the dead-letter store — nothing is lost yet. Replace the expired credential in the dispatcher config with the new key below.

gateway credential: kto23_LX9A4ys6i4nzHtpOLNLodKK

## TICKET: tailcat plugin rejected — signature check failed

Plugin authors: tailcat v4 now verifies plugin bundles at load. The `fernline-filter` plugin failed with SIG_MISMATCH because it was signed against the deprecated v3 key. Fix: re-sign with the current key and bump your manifest version. Old signatures are rejected as of this release — no override flag. Re-sign all plugins using the key below.

rollout seal: bky4_DFM9

## Runbook — Stagelight Seat-Map Renderer

Scope for weekly sync: renderer latency and blank-grid incidents at the Marrowgate venue. If seat grid renders blank, check the layout cache first; a cold cache after deploy is expected for ~90 seconds. If it persists, the venue blueprint version likely mismatches the renderer schema — roll back the blueprint, not the service. Latency over 800ms usually means the SVG tessellation fallback kicked in. Escalations go through the rendering rotation. Deploys must cite the build token listed below.

pipeline stamp: htk9_ce63042d9

Ticket: Config drift on the address autocomplete widget

The Mapliner autocomplete widget behaves differently across regions again. Someone hot-patched the debounce interval and result cap directly on the edge boxes in the Corvall cluster, and those values never made it back into the repo. Suggestions now lag in one region and flood in another. Reviewer: please diff the live values against what's checked in. For reference, production is currently running with these settings.

service settings:
[casax]
port = 6379
team = rusir
host = casax.zemvarhq.corp
region = outer-4
access_code = ac_9808ce
timeout_ms = 1500